Win7系统安装MySQL教程
在win7 如何装MYSQL

首页 2025-06-15 11:01:41



在Win7上如何安装MySQL:详细步骤与指南 MySQL是一种广泛使用的关系型数据库管理系统(RDBMS),它通过结构化查询语言(SQL)进行数据管理,广泛应用于Web应用程序、企业级应用以及各类数据存储需求

    尽管Windows 7操作系统已经逐渐退出历史舞台,但许多用户仍在使用它,并需要在这一环境下安装MySQL

    本文将详细介绍在Windows 7上如何安装MySQL,确保过程清晰、步骤详尽,帮助用户顺利完成安装

     一、准备工作 在安装MySQL之前,请确保你的计算机满足以下要求: 1.操作系统:Windows 7 Ultimate或其他版本(建议使用最新更新)

     2.硬件要求:至少1GB RAM,足够的磁盘空间用于安装和数据存储

     3.管理员权限:确保你拥有管理员权限,以便能够安装软件和服务

     此外,你还需要访问MySQL官方网站(【https://dev.mysql.com/downloads/mysql/】(https://dev.mysql.com/downloads/mysql/))下载适用于Windows的安装包

    可以选择MySQL Community Server(免费)或MySQL Enterprise Edition(付费)

     二、下载安装包 1.访问MySQL官网: 打开浏览器,访问MySQL的官方网站

    在下载页面,选择“MySQL Community(GPL) Downloads”

     2.选择MySQL Community Server: 在下载选项中,选择MySQL Community Server,这是MySQL的开源版本,适用于大多数用户

     3.下载安装包: 根据你的操作系统版本(32位或64位),选择合适的安装包进行下载

    安装包通常以`.msi`格式提供,例如`mysql-installer-community-x.x.x.msi`

     三、安装MySQL 1.运行安装程序: 下载完成后,双击安装文件启动安装向导

    可能会弹出用户账户控制提示,点击“是”以继续

     2.选择安装类型: 在安装向导中,选择“Custom”安装类型,以便可以自定义安装路径和组件

    这将允许你选择需要安装的MySQL组件,如MySQL Server、MySQL Workbench(可视化工具)等

     3.选择组件: 在“Select Products and Features”页面,确保选择“MySQL Server”

    你还可以选择安装其他组件,根据你的需求进行配置

     4.配置MySQL Server: 在“Configure the MySQL Server now”页面,点击“Next”进入配置阶段

    选择“Developer Machine”配置类型,适用于开发和测试环境;或者选择“Server Machine”,适用于多用户环境

     5.设置root用户密码: 在“Account and Roles”页面,设置root用户的密码,并确认密码

    这是MySQL数据库的管理员账户,务必妥善保管密码

     6.选择存储引擎: 在“MySQL Server”页面,选择默认的存储引擎(通常为InnoDB)

    InnoDB是MySQL的默认存储引擎,提供了事务支持、行级锁定和外键约束等高级功能

     7.配置网络: 在“Networking”页面,选择是否启用TCP/IP网络,并设置端口号(默认为3306)

    这是MySQL服务器监听的端口,用于客户端连接

     8.开始安装: 点击“Execute”按钮开始安装过程

    安装程序将安装所需的组件并配置MySQL服务器

    安装过程中可能需要一些时间,请耐心等待

     9.完成安装: 安装完成后,点击“Finish”按钮完成安装

    此时,MySQL服务器应该已经启动并运行

     四、验证与配置 1.验证安装: 打开命令提示符(cmd),输入以下命令验证MySQL是否安装成功: bash mysql -u root -p 输入之前设置的root用户密码,如果成功登录,说明MySQL安装成功

    你将看到MySQL的欢迎信息,并能够执行SQL查询

     2.配置环境变量: 为了方便在命令行中运行MySQL命令,你可以将MySQL的bin目录添加到系统的PATH环境变量中

     - 右击桌面的“计算机”图标,选择“属性”

     - 点击“高级系统设置”,然后点击“环境变量”

     - 在“系统变量”中找到“Path”,点击“编辑”

     - 在变量值的末尾添加MySQL bin目录的路径,例如`%MYSQL_HOME%bin`(确保前面有分号分隔)

     - 点击“确定”保存更改

     3.初始化数据库: 在某些情况下,你可能需要手动初始化数据库

    这可以通过在MySQL bin目录下运行以下命令完成: bash mysqld --initialize --console 该命令将生成一个初始密码,你可以在输出中找到它

    记住这个密码,因为稍后你需要用它来登录MySQL

     4.启动和停止MySQL服务: 你可以通过“服务”管理器来查看和管理MySQL服务的状态

     - 打开“运行”对话框(按Win + R),输入`services.msc`并按回车

     - 在服务列表中找到“MySQL”服务,你可以右键点击它来选择启动、停止或重启

     五、优化与排错 1.优化MySQL性能: 为了提高MySQL的性能,你可以根据硬件资源和业务需求调整MySQL的配置参数

    这包括内存分配、缓存大小、连接数等

     - 打开MySQL的配置文件(通常是`my.ini`或`my.cnf`),在`【mysqld】`部分进行修改

     - 例如,增加`innodb_buffer_pool_size`的值可以提高InnoDB存储引擎的性能

     2.排查问题: 如果在安装或使用过程中遇到问题,你可以通过以下步骤进行排查: - 检查MySQL服务是否已启动

     - 查看MySQL的错误日志(通常在MySQL数据目录下),以获取详细的错误信息

     - 确保防火墙允许MySQL端口(默认3306)的通信

     - 检查MySQL配置文件中的路径和设置是否正确

     3.寻求帮助: 如果问题依然无法解决,你可以参考MySQL的官方文档(【https://dev.mysql.com/doc/】(https://dev.mysql.com/doc/)),或在MySQL社区论坛中寻求帮助

     六、总结 在Windows 7上安装MySQL可能涉及多个步骤和配置选项,但只要你按照本文提供的指南进行操作,就能顺利完成安装

    通过合理配置和优化,MySQL将成为你开发和测试的强大后盾

    无论是在Web应用程序、企业级应用还是数据存储需求中,MySQL都能提供稳定、高效的数据管理服务

    希望本文能帮助你在Windows 7上成功安装和配置MySQL数据库!

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道